|
|
|
@ -14,14 +14,19 @@
|
|
|
|
|
{{ $ctrl.model.Title }}
|
|
|
|
|
</span>
|
|
|
|
|
<div class="space-left blocklist-item-subtitle inline-flex items-center">
|
|
|
|
|
<div ng-if="$ctrl.typeLabel !== 'manifest'" class="vertical-center gap-1">
|
|
|
|
|
<pr-icon ng-if="$ctrl.model.Platform === 1 || $ctrl.model.Platform === 'linux' || !$ctrl.model.Platform" icon="'svg-linux'" class="mr-1"></pr-icon>
|
|
|
|
|
<span ng-if="!$ctrl.model.Platform"> & </span>
|
|
|
|
|
<pr-icon
|
|
|
|
|
icon="'svg-microsoft'"
|
|
|
|
|
ng-if="$ctrl.model.Platform === 2 || $ctrl.model.Platform === 'windows' || !$ctrl.model.Platform"
|
|
|
|
|
class-name="'[&>*]:flex [&>*]:items-center'"
|
|
|
|
|
size="'lg'"
|
|
|
|
|
></pr-icon>
|
|
|
|
|
</div>
|
|
|
|
|
<!-- currently only kubernetes uses the typeLabel of 'manifest' -->
|
|
|
|
|
<div ng-if="$ctrl.typeLabel === 'manifest'" class="vertical-center">
|
|
|
|
|
<pr-icon icon="'svg-kubernetes'" size="'lg'" class="align-bottom" class-name="'[&>*]:flex [&>*]:items-center'"></pr-icon>
|
|
|
|
|
</div>
|
|
|
|
|
{{ $ctrl.typeLabel }}
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|